The Nokia C1 2nd Edition succeeds the Nokia C1 released in 2019. The device retains a similar physical design but includes several updates. The display resolution has been increased to 720p from the previous 480p. The operating system has been upgraded to Android 11, replacing the older model’s Android 9 Pie.
The phone is equipped wiht a 1.3 GHz quad-core Spreadtrum/UniSoC SC7731E processor. It includes 1 GB of RAM and 16 GB of internal storage, which can be expanded by up to 32 GB using a microSD card. This configuration supports basic smartphone functions and light applications.
In terms of imaging, the Nokia C1 2nd Edition features a single 5-megapixel rear camera with an LED flash. The front-facing camera is also 5 megapixels and supports facial recognition for device unlocking. The device does not have a fingerprint sensor.
Connectivity options are limited to 2G and 3G networks. The phone is powered by a 2500 mAh battery. Physical dimensions measure approximately 148.0 x 71.8 x 9.3 mm, and the device weighs 154 grams. Available colour variants include Blue and Purple.
The Nokia C1 2nd edition is designed as an entry-level smartphone with basic hardware and software specifications suitable for essential mobile tasks.
